Rape convict Dera Sacha Sauda chief Gurmeet Ram Rahim gets 40-day parole; will return to jail mid-September

CHANDIGARH: The Haryana government on Tuesday once again released Gurmeet Ram Rahim, a convict in rape and murder cases heading Dera Sacha Sauda (DSS) Sirsa, on 40-days parole. He will be returning back to jail barracks on September 14. With this, in the past four months period from January 1 to September 14, he will be out of jail for 91 days. Earlier in April, the state government had released him on 21 day’s furlough. As per the bail conditions, he will be staying at his Sirsa based ashram. He was released from the Sunaria jail in Rohtak on Tuesday and immediately left for his Dera in Sirsa. The detailed order was not available till the filing of this report. The Dera chief is currently serving a sentence in Rohtak’s Sunaria jail since August 2017. On August 25, 2017, a special CBI court in Panchkula convicted him for the rape of Sadhvis (female disciples) and sentenced him to two terms of 20 years imprisonment. He is currently serving a sentence for rape and a journalist’s murder case. Around 40 persons lost their lives in August 2017 after violence took place in Panchkula and other parts of Haryana and Punjab after he was convicted for rape cases.
